The rate is set by the insurer and can be anywhere from 25% to more than 100%. (The insurance firm can likewise change the get involved rate over the life time of the policy.) For instance, if the gain is 6%, the involvement rate is 50%, and the existing cash value total amount is $10,000, $300 is added to the cash worth (6% x 50% x $10,000 = $300).
There are a number of pros and disadvantages to take into consideration prior to acquiring an IUL policy.: Similar to conventional global life insurance, the insurance holder can increase their costs or lower them in times of hardship.: Quantities credited to the cash money worth grow tax-deferred. The cash value can pay the insurance coverage costs, enabling the insurance holder to decrease or quit making out-of-pocket premium repayments.
Many IUL policies have a later maturation day than various other sorts of universal life policies, with some finishing when the insured reaches age 121 or even more. If the insured is still to life back then, plans pay out the survivor benefit (but not usually the cash money worth) and the earnings might be taxable.
: Smaller policy face values do not provide much advantage over regular UL insurance policies.: If the index goes down, no passion is attributed to the cash value.
With IUL, the objective is to make money from upward motions in the index.: Since the insurance provider only buys choices in an index, you're not directly invested in stocks, so you don't profit when business pay returns to shareholders.: Insurers cost costs for managing your cash, which can drain money value.
For most individuals, no, IUL isn't far better than a 401(k) in regards to conserving for retired life. The majority of IULs are best for high-net-worth people searching for ways to minimize their gross income or those who have actually maxed out their various other retired life options. For everybody else, a 401(k) is a far better investment automobile since it doesn't lug the high charges and costs of an IUL, plus there is no cap on the amount you might make (unlike with an IUL plan).
While you might not shed any money in the account if the index drops, you won't gain rate of interest. If the marketplace transforms bullish, the earnings on your IUL will not be as high as a normal investment account. The high expense of costs and costs makes IULs pricey and considerably less cost effective than term life.
Indexed universal life (IUL) insurance supplies money value plus a fatality benefit. The money in the cash money value account can earn interest through tracking an equity index, and with some often designated to a fixed-rate account. Nonetheless, Indexed global life plans cap just how much money you can collect (commonly at much less than 100%) and they are based upon a possibly unstable equity index.
A 401(k) is a far better choice for that function because it does not bring the high charges and costs of an IUL plan, plus there is no cap on the quantity you might gain when invested. The majority of IUL plans are best for high-net-worth individuals seeking to decrease their gross income. The money value of an Indexed Universal Life plan can be accessed with plan fundings or withdrawals. Withdrawals will certainly minimize the fatality benefit, and loans will accrue rate of interest, which must be paid back to keep the plan effective.
